A Psalm of David

Appears in 2 hymnals Scripture: Psalm 51 First Line: O God, have mercy upon me Lyrics: 1 O God, have mercy upon me according to thy grace; According to thy mercies great, my trespasses efface. 2 O wash me throughly from my guilt, and from my sin me clear; 3 For I my trespass own; my sins before me still appear. 4 Against Thee, Thee alone I sinn'd; the crime was in thy sight: So when Thou speakest Thou art just; and thy whole judgment right. 5 Behold, how in iniquity I did my shape receive; And that my mother stain'd from sin, in sin did me conceive. 6 Behold, thou dost desire the truth within the inward part: O do Thou make me wisdom know in secret of my heart. 7 With sprinkling hyssop cleanse thou me, and I shall spotless grow: O wash Thou me, and then shall I be whiter than the snow. [2 Part] 8 Of joy and gladness make Thou me to hear again the voice; That so the bones which Thou hast broke may yet again rejoyce. 9 From the beholding of my sins O turn away thy face; And all my vie iniquities O do Thou quite efface. 10 Clean heart O GOD, in me create; renew a spirit right In me: (11) and cast me not away out of thy happy sight: Nor thy Pure Spirit from me take. 12 Restore the joy to me, Of thy salvation, and uphold me with thy spirit free. 13 Then will I teach thy ways to those who work iniquity; And happily shall sinners then, converted be to Thee. [3 Part] 14 O GOD! of my salvation God! free me from guilt of blood; And of thy saving righteousness my tongue shall sing aloud. 15 Lord, open Thou my lips, and forth my mouth thy praise shall sing: 16 For Thou desir'st not sacrifice; or I the same would bring: Burnt off'rings Thou delight'st not in. 17 Of GOD the sacrifice A spirit broke: a contrite heart, GOD Thou wilt not despise. 18 In thy good pleasure, O do good to Zion bounteously: The walls of thy Jerusalem, O build Thou up on high. 19 The sacrifice of righteousness shall pleas Thee then; and they Burnt off'rings, whole burnt off'rings, calves, will on thine altar lay.

O God! have mercy upon me

Appears in 2 hymnals Scripture: Psalm 51 Lyrics: 1 O God! have mercy upon me, According to thy bounteous grace; And in thy mercies multitude My many trespasses efface. 2 O wash me throughly from my guilt, And from my sin me purify: 3 For all my sins I freely own; My sin is always in mine eye. 4 Against Thee, Thee alone I sinn'd, This crime committed in thy sight; So when Thou speakest, Thou art just, Thy judgment stands intirely right. 5 Behold, I with abasement own, I shap'd was in iniquity; And that my mother stain'd with sin, She ev'n in sin conceived me. 6 Behold, it is the truth that Thou Desirest in the inward part: O do Thou make me wisdom know Within the secret of my heart. 7 With sprinkling hyssop cleanse Thy me, And I will pure and spotless grow; O wash and make me wholly clean; And I shall whiter be than snow. [2 Part] 9 Of joy and gladness make Thou me, To hear again the welcome voice; That so the bones which Thou hast broke May happily again rejoyce. 9 From the beholding of my sins For ever turn away thine eyes; And do Thou utterly efface All my abhor'd iniquities. 10 O GOD, create in me an heart Both clean and holy in thy sight, And in me, O do Thou renew A spirit steady and upright. Cast me not from thy face; nor take Thy Holy Spirit now from me; 12 Restore me thy salvation's joy: Uphold me with thy spirit free. 13 Then from a bless'd experience I Will sinners teach thy happy ways; And sinners shall converted be, To Thee, to love, obey and praise. [3 Part] 14 O GOD! of my salvation God! Deliver me from guilt of blood; And of thy saving righteousness My joyful tongue will sing aloud. 15 Lord, open Thou these lips of mine, Which by my sin fast closed are: And then will my enlarged mouth thy praises publickly declare 16 For Thou desir'st not sacrifice Of beast, that I might bring to Thee; Nor in burnt off'rings dost delight, That Thou should'st them accept of me. 17 But 'tis a spirit broke for sin, Is GOD's approved sacrifice: A broken and a contrite heart O GOD, Thou never wilt despise. 18 And now to Zion, O do good In thy good pleasure bounteously; And of our dear Jerusalem, Do Thou build up the walls on high. 19 Then Thou shalt with the sacrifice Of righteousness well pleased be; Burnt off'rings, whole burnt off'rings, calves, They'll at thine altar offer Thee.
